West Sussex Council are looking for a Senior Communications and Engagement Officer - (Communications) to join their team.

We are looking for someone to do 18.5 hours (very flexible on days/times) - initial contract length 6 months but may be until March 2022.

We are looking for an enthusiastic and motivated senior communications professional to oversee and run our communications campaigns for our Proud to Care initiative. You will have experience in leading and shaping campaigns and generating content for a variety of channels. You will have a very good understanding of social media and digital communications and will have experience working with broadcast and print media to promote campaigns.

You will be an excellent communicator with an ability to work with people at all levels of the organisation and create great content. The role is part of the wider County Council's Communications and Engagement Team where there is lots of support and opportunities to learn new skills.

You will work exclusively with the Proud to Care team on it's exciting programme of activities which specifically looks to recruit and encourage more people to consider working in social care. We need you to contribute content to our own website, manage our facebook account and carry out digital advertising and regularly interview carers to get great insight and case studies to feature and inform our campaigns.

Pay rate: GBP17.06 per hour PAYE / GBP20.96 per hour Umbrella PAYE
